Brick Hardscape Construction in Manchester, NH
Brick hardscape construction services encompass the design and installation of durable, visually appealing features made from brick materials. This includes creating pat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, and outdoor seating areas that enhance the functionality and aesthetic of residential properties. Property owners often seek these services to improve curb appeal, define outdoor spaces, or add structural elements that withstand weather and regular use over time.
Before requesting brick hardscape construction, homeowners typically want to understand the scope of the project, including material options, design possibilities, and the overall durability of the finished work. It’s also helpful to consider the existing landscape and any necessary site preparation, such as leveling or drainage adjustments. Clear communication about expectations and desired outcomes can ensure the project aligns with the property’s style and long-term maintenance needs.

Common Brick Hardscape Construction Jobs
Patio Construction - custom brick patios designed for outdoor living and entertaining.
Walkway Installation - durable brick walkways that enhance curb appeal and accessibility.
Retaining Walls - sturdy brick walls to manage slopes and prevent erosion.
Driveway Paving - brick driveways that combine functionality with aesthetic appeal.
Garden Borders - decorative brick edging to define planting beds and landscape features.
Fireplace and Fire Pit - built-in brick fireplaces and fire pits for cozy outdoor gatherings.
Brick Hardscape Construction Questions
What types of projects are common for brick hardscape construction? Typical projects include patios, walkways, retaining walls, and garden borders that enhance outdoor spaces.
What materials are used in brick hardscape construction? Common materials include clay bricks, concrete bricks, and stone pavers, chosen for durability and aesthetic appeal.
How does brick hardscaping improve property value? Well-designed brick features add curb appeal and functional outdoor living areas, increasing overall property attractiveness.
What should property owners consider before starting a brick hardscape project? It's important to plan the layout, consider drainage needs, and select materials that complement the property’s style.
